What's For Desert? (Table of Contents: 3)

Betty and Veronica / comic story / 5 pages (report information)

Script
Bill Golliher; Dan Parent
Pencils
Dan DeCarlo
Inks
Alison Flood
Colors
Barry Grossman
Letters
Bill Yoshida

Genre
teen
Characters
Betty Cooper; Veronica Lodge; Hiram Lodge
Synopsis
On a trip to Yellowstone National Park, Mr. Lodge's private jet has to put down in the desert for repairs. While they wait the repairs out, Betty and Veronica have some fun filming a desert tortoise for a nature documentary Betty is making for a school project.

Grin And Bear It (Table of Contents: 6)

Betty and Veronica / comic story / 5 pages (report information)

Script
Bill Golliher; Dan Parent
Pencils
Dan DeCarlo
Inks
Alison Flood
Colors
Barry Grossman
Letters
Bill Yoshida

Genre
teen
Characters
Betty Cooper; Veronica Lodge; Hiram Lodge
Synopsis
While camping in Yellowstone National Park, Betty takes the time to tape more wildlife for her documentary. Meanwhile Veronica goes to war with a brown bear that has stolen her travel bag full of expensive make up.
